What to Expect on Test Day
It's crucial for prospects to get here prepared on test day. Here's what to anticipate:
Identification: Bring a legitimate passport or national ID.Arrival Time: Arrive at least 30 minutes early to avoid last-minute stress.Test Format: The IELTS test consists of 4 areas, which can be taken in various orders:Listening: Approximately 30 minutes.Reading: 60 minutes.Composing: 60 minutes.Speaking: 11-14 minutes (scheduled on the same day or as much as a week before or after).Preparation Resources

What is the validity duration of the IELTS score?
IELTS scores stand for 2 years from the test date.
2. Can I alter my test date after signing up?
Yes, you can alter your test date, but it usually requires a cost. Refer to your test center's policy for specifics.
3. How is the IELTS scoring system structured?
Each section is scored from 0 to 9, and a general band rating is computed as an average of the 4 section scores.
